Custom ʻIʻiwi Tenor Ukulele

 
 

Circa 2025. Custom I’iwi Ukulele. Phenomenal player ukulele! Custom ʻI’iwi Tenor Ukulele handcrafted by luthier Charlie Fukuba of Makakilo, Oahu. This special piece is the premier model offered by ʻI’iwi Ukuleles and is defined as, the Gold ‘Master’ Series. The ‘Master’ series is a testimony to the ʻI’iwi Ukulele commitment to the finest materials and craftsmanship in skilled luthiery by one of Hawaii’s foremost custom ukulele luthiers, Charlie Fukuba.

Handcrafted of gorgeous master grade curly Hawaiian Koa wood face, back, and sides, this full custom ‘Master’ ʻI’iwi ukulele also boasts instrument-grade Gabon ebony fretboard and bridge with a rocklite headstock veneer. Elegant and contrasting Maple wood top and back binding with an elegant top and side profile, maple wood purfling for aesthetic appeal. The neck itself has been carved from Honduran mahogany for increased structural integrity and sustain. Polynesian-inspired maple and abalone shell markers on positions 3, 5, 7, 10, 12, and 15 add a quick and accurate reference point to each chord. Three subtle abalone shell rosettes on a tone-tapped upper bout porting system for elegant appeal.  The porting system adds projection, sustain, and accented bass notes for the player and also encompasses a contemporary theme into the instrument while capturing the true ‘Aloha Spirit’ by which this gorgeous instrument was handcrafted, connecting the people and character of Hawaii. The piece brings you back to a time of simplicity in ancient Hawaii. A time when the feathers of ʻI’iwi birds were gently plucked for the ʻahuʻula (feather cloaks) and mahiole (feathered helmets) of the Hawaiian monarchs or ali`i.

Tonally, this piece is a true gem and a remarkable piece for recording musicians or weekend jam sessions. Full recording level instrument with voiced high tones, embellished mid-range notes and exceptional bass. Excellent clarity and projection as well. Very well balanced structurally and tonally, with refined notes all the way up the neck and spot-on intonation.
